Woodstone Saxophones
Ishimori Wind Instruments opened in 1951 as a repair shop dedicated to providing expert service to musicians in Japan and has become a destination spot for visiting saxophonists. Master craftsmen Shinji Ishimori founded Ishimori Woodstone in the late 1990s with an initial focus on creating high-quality ligatures for saxophone and clarinet. Ishimori quickly expanded his product line which now includes reeds, mouthpieces, saxophones and various accessories.
